Automotive Steering System Market

Automotive Steering System Market

The Automotive Steering System Market plays a vital role in vehicle safety, performance, and driving comfort. Steering systems are evolving rapidly as the automotive industry transitions toward electrification, advanced driver assistance systems (ADAS), and autonomous mobility. Modern vehicles increasingly rely on electric power steering (EPS), steer-by-wire technologies, and integrated electronic control systems that enhance precision and efficiency.

For automotive manufacturers and suppliers, steering technology has become a strategic area of innovation. Companies are investing heavily in lightweight materials, software-driven steering control, and scalable platforms compatible with electric vehicles. As a result, competition among leading automotive suppliers has intensified, with both established global firms and emerging innovators shaping the future of the Automotive Steering System Market.

Top Companies & Their Strategies

Several global automotive component manufacturers dominate the Automotive Steering System Market through strong R&D capabilities, global supply networks, and partnerships with major vehicle OEMs.

Robert Bosch GmbH

Robert Bosch GmbH is a key supplier of steering systems and related automotive technologies. The company's strategy focuses on integrating steering with electronic stability control, braking systems, and advanced driver assistance platforms. Bosch has developed advanced electric power steering solutions that improve vehicle efficiency and compatibility with hybrid and electric vehicles. Its global presence and long-standing relationships with major automakers provide a strong competitive advantage.

JTEKT Corporation

JTEKT Corporation, known for its EPS technologies under the Koyo brand, is a major innovator in steering system engineering. The company focuses heavily on next-generation EPS and steer-by-wire systems. JTEKT leverages its strong ties with Japanese automakers while expanding its global manufacturing footprint to serve North American and European markets.

ZF Friedrichshafen AG

ZF Friedrichshafen AG is one of the most influential suppliers in the Automotive Steering System Market. Through acquisitions and internal innovation, ZF offers a comprehensive portfolio including steering columns, electric steering gear, and autonomous-ready steering platforms. Its strategy centers on integrating steering with ADAS and automated driving technologies, positioning the company as a partner for next-generation mobility solutions.

Nexteer Automotive

Nexteer Automotive specializes in steering and driveline technologies and has emerged as a leader in electric power steering. The company emphasizes cost-efficient EPS solutions tailored to both premium and mass-market vehicles. Nexteer's strong engineering expertise and partnerships with global OEMs allow it to maintain a competitive edge.

Hyundai Mobis

Hyundai Mobis plays a critical role in supplying steering systems to Hyundai and Kia vehicles while also expanding its external customer base. The company invests heavily in electronic steering systems and autonomous driving technologies. Its vertically integrated manufacturing structure enables cost efficiencies and rapid innovation.

NSK Ltd.

NSK Ltd. is well known for precision engineering and high-quality steering components. The company focuses on lightweight EPS designs and high-durability components that enhance fuel efficiency and vehicle handling. NSK's strong reputation for reliability supports its global customer relationships.

Thyssenkrupp AG

Thyssenkrupp AG has a significant presence in steering columns and advanced steering technologies. Its automotive division focuses on lightweight design and modular steering platforms. The company's engineering capabilities allow it to collaborate closely with OEMs during vehicle platform development.

SWOT Analysis

Strengths

Leading players in the automotive steering system market benefit from strong engineering expertise and deep relationships with global automakers. Companies such as Bosch, ZF, and Nexteer have decades of experience in steering technology and large patent portfolios that support innovation. Their global manufacturing networks allow them to supply steering systems to multiple automotive platforms efficiently. In addition, many suppliers are investing in digital technologies that integrate steering with ADAS and autonomous driving systems.

Weaknesses

Despite technological leadership, steering system manufacturers face significant challenges related to high R&D costs and complex product development cycles. Developing next-generation steering systems, particularly steer-by-wire technologies, requires substantial investment in electronics, sensors, and software integration. In addition, many suppliers remain heavily dependent on automotive production volumes, making them vulnerable to fluctuations in vehicle demand.

Opportunities

The transition toward electric vehicles and autonomous mobility creates major opportunities in the Automotive Steering System Market. Electric power steering systems are replacing traditional hydraulic steering systems in most modern vehicles due to their efficiency and compatibility with electronic control systems. Suppliers that develop scalable EPS platforms or advanced steer-by-wire solutions stand to benefit significantly. Additionally, growing automotive production in emerging economies offers opportunities for suppliers to expand manufacturing and distribution networks.

Threats

Competitive pressure remains intense as both established automotive suppliers and new technology entrants compete for OEM partnerships. The rapid pace of technological change also increases the risk that existing steering technologies could become obsolete. Supply chain disruptions, raw material price volatility, and geopolitical tensions can affect production and logistics for global suppliers. Furthermore, strict safety regulations require extensive testing and certification, increasing costs and development timelines.

Investment Opportunities & Trends

Investment activity in the Automotive Steering System Market is increasingly focused on technologies that support electrification, automation, and vehicle digitalization. As steering systems become electronically controlled, software capabilities and sensor integration are becoming as important as mechanical engineering.

Growth of Electric Power Steering Technologies

One of the most significant investment areas is electric power steering (EPS) technology. EPS systems eliminate hydraulic components and rely on electric motors and electronic control units, improving energy efficiency and vehicle performance. Automakers are rapidly adopting EPS in passenger cars, electric vehicles, and commercial vehicles, driving demand for advanced steering components.

Steer-by-Wire Development

Steer-by-wire systems represent the next stage in steering evolution. These systems eliminate the mechanical link between the steering wheel and the wheels, replacing it with electronic controls. This technology enables greater design flexibility, enhanced safety features, and integration with autonomous driving platforms. Companies developing reliable steer-by-wire architectures are attracting considerable investment interest.

Integration with ADAS and Autonomous Driving

Modern vehicles rely heavily on advanced driver assistance systems such as lane-keeping assistance and automated parking. Steering systems must integrate seamlessly with these technologies to allow precise electronic control. Suppliers that offer integrated steering platforms compatible with ADAS sensors, cameras, and software platforms are gaining strategic partnerships with automotive manufacturers.

Regional Expansion and Manufacturing Investments

Automotive steering system suppliers are expanding manufacturing capabilities in regions with strong automotive production ecosystems. Asia-Pacific, particularly China, Japan, and South Korea, remains a key manufacturing hub for steering components. Companies are also increasing investments in North America and Europe to support local production and supply chain resilience.

Mergers, Acquisitions, and Partnerships

Strategic collaborations and acquisitions continue to reshape the competitive landscape of the Automotive Steering System Market. Technology partnerships between automotive suppliers and software developers are becoming more common as steering systems incorporate advanced electronic control features. Companies are also acquiring specialized firms with expertise in sensors, electronic control units, and autonomous driving software.

Recent Developments

Over the past year, several notable developments have influenced the market. Leading steering system suppliers have introduced new EPS platforms designed specifically for electric vehicles. Automotive component companies have also expanded partnerships with OEMs developing autonomous vehicle platforms. In addition, policy initiatives promoting vehicle electrification and safety technologies have encouraged automakers to adopt advanced steering systems with improved electronic control capabilities.
